10 Best Budgeting Apps for Couples in 2026
Managing money together becomes much easier when you have the right tools. Budgeting apps help couples track expenses, monitor savings, organize bills, and stay focused on shared financial goals.

Here are some of the best budgeting apps couples can consider in 2026.
1. YNAB (You Need A Budget)
YNAB focuses on giving every dollar a job and is ideal for couples who want detailed budgeting and goal tracking.
2. Monarch Money
Monarch Money offers collaborative financial planning, account syncing, budgeting, and investment tracking.
3. EveryDollar
This app follows zero-based budgeting principles and is easy for beginners to use.
4. Goodbudget
Goodbudget uses the envelope budgeting system, making it easy for couples to allocate spending categories.
5. PocketGuard
PocketGuard helps users understand how much money is available to spend after bills and savings.
6. Honeydue
Designed specifically for couples, Honeydue allows partners to track shared expenses while maintaining financial transparency.
7. Empower Personal Dashboard
Useful for couples who want to monitor budgeting, investments, and overall net worth.
8. Simplifi
Simplifi provides spending insights, cash flow tracking, and financial planning tools.
9. Rocket Money
Rocket Money helps identify subscriptions, manage bills, and monitor spending habits.
10. Choose the App That Fits Your Relationship
The best budgeting app is the one both partners enjoy using consistently.
Final Thoughts
Budgeting apps simplify financial management, encourage teamwork, and make it easier to achieve long-term goals together.
Pairing the right budgeting app with open communication and regular financial check-ins can help couples build lasting financial success.
